Single mother Jane Hartley is devastated when she sees her
sixteen-year-old daughter Kelly riding a motorcycle without
a helmet, accompanied by a young man Jane has never met. As
a small child, Kelly survived cancer and the devastating
treatments required to save her life. How can Kelly take
such risks with the second chance at life she's been given?
Who is this mystery man and how does Kelly know him?
The next morning, Jane discovers her daughter is missing,
having left only a message saying she'll call later that
day. When that call comes, Jane knows something has gone
horribly wrong. The call is abruptly terminated and no
further contact is achieved, so Jane reports her daughter
missing. Police think Kelly may be merely another teenage
runaway. But they do give Jane the number of a former FBI
agent, Randall Shane, who may be able to help.
Things get murky really fast. Is Kelly a runaway with her
new friend Sean? Or has something terrible happened to
Kelly—and maybe Sean too? The police aren't any help and
Sean's father is acting very strange. Jane must rely on
Randall Shane's wits to figure out what happened and to
recover her daughter alive. How do a billionaire, a missing
airplane, a Florida American Indian-owned casino and a
madman factor into this puzzling disappearance? Without
getting into spoiler territory, I can say that Shane's
skills will be stretched to their limits in this unusual case.
TRAPPED is a pulse-pounding nonstop thrill ride from start
to finish. Squeamish readers, be forewarned that there is a
significant amount of on-screen violence throughout,
especially during the latter third of the book. I found the
use of present tense a little disconcerting at first but
finally adapted to the style by the finale. Multiple POVs
are used, giving readers tantalizing peeks at the thoughts
and actions of everyone involved. Thriller fans will want to
snap up this latest offering from Mr. Jordan.
